Update ci.yml

This commit is contained in:
Tomaae 2023-01-16 01:49:54 +01:00 committed by GitHub
parent 7b8fe02c7e
commit bb8a14999e
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-19,7 +19,7 @@ jobs:
runs-on: ubuntu-latest runs-on: ubuntu-latest
steps: steps:
- name: Check out code from GitHub - name: Check out code from GitHub
uses: "actions/checkout@v2" uses: "actions/checkout@v3"
- name: Black Code Format Check - name: Black Code Format Check
uses: lgeiger/black-action@master uses: lgeiger/black-action@master
with: with:
@ -30,11 +30,11 @@ jobs:
runs-on: ubuntu-latest runs-on: ubuntu-latest
steps: steps:
- name: Check out code from GitHub - name: Check out code from GitHub
uses: "actions/checkout@v2" uses: "actions/checkout@v3"
- name: Set up Python 3.9 - name: Set up Python 3.10
uses: actions/setup-python@v1 uses: actions/setup-python@v4
with: with:
python-version: 3.9 python-version: 3.10
- name: Generate Requirements lists - name: Generate Requirements lists
run: | run: |
python3 .github/generate_requirements.py python3 .github/generate_requirements.py
@ -59,7 +59,7 @@ jobs:
runs-on: ubuntu-latest runs-on: ubuntu-latest
steps: steps:
- name: Check out code from GitHub - name: Check out code from GitHub
uses: "actions/checkout@v2" uses: "actions/checkout@v3"
- name: Security check - Bandit - name: Security check - Bandit
uses: ioggstream/bandit-report-artifacts@v0.0.2 uses: ioggstream/bandit-report-artifacts@v0.0.2
with: with:
@ -78,6 +78,6 @@ jobs:
runs-on: "ubuntu-latest" runs-on: "ubuntu-latest"
steps: steps:
- name: Check out code from GitHub - name: Check out code from GitHub
uses: "actions/checkout@v2" uses: "actions/checkout@v3"
- name: Run hassfest - name: Run hassfest
uses: home-assistant/actions/hassfest@master uses: home-assistant/actions/hassfest@master